The nation of France Facing Political Turmoil as PM Resigns
Welcome and join us for the European ongoing coverage. The focus is squarely today rests upon Paris, which has been entering a state of political instability as the premier, Sébastien Lecornu, resigns after less than a month in the role.
France's head of state confirmed his exit earlier today after the ministerial team the president announced late on Sunday was met with strong opposition across the political spectrum.
